Survey on Rear Anti-tip Devices for Manual Wheelchairs

The Wheelchair Research Team at Dalhousie University is seeking feedback from English-speaking wheelchair service providers through a short survey about rear anti-tip devices (RADs) for manual wheelchairs.
This 20-minute survey focuses on a new design, the Arc-RAD, that the team hopes to refine and commercialize. Your insights could directly influence the next generation of RADs and ensure that they truly meet the needs of riders and providers alike.
